Dr. James Dobson Endorses Coburn
Dear Friend,
In the course of my professional career in defense of families, I have had a chance
to get to know some of our nation's leading political figures. The one who has impressed
me most, however, is not a professional politician at all; he is a family doctor from
Muskogee, Oklahoma.
Dr. Tom Coburn was so concerned about the direction our country was taking that
he decided to go to Washington to help make a difference. Elected to Congress in the
historic class of 1994, he vowed to be a citizen-legislator serving no more than three
terms. He not only kept that promise, but he made every day count during his six years in
Congress.
Dr. Coburn led the way on numerous health issues, including a dramatic revision
of our nation's failed approach to the AIDS epidemic. He was a courageous and effective
voice for fiscal responsibility on this and other important issues. And, above all, he was
the single best leader I ever worked with on the critical moral and family issues that have
been at the heart of my own work.
After his wonderful term of service in congress, Dr. Coburn returned home to the
full-time practice of medicine and to enjoy his grandchildren. But now, the call to duty in
Washington has presented itself again. One of Oklahoma's U.S. Senators, Don Nickles,
is retiring from office this year, and people from across the state and throughout the
nation have beseeched Dr. Coburn to become a candidate for that office.
In spite of a great deal of reluctance to leave the community he loves for a second
time, Tom Coburn is answering that call. He is a candidate for the open Senate seat from
Oklahoma in 2004. He started this race late and far behind in competition with
formidable and well-funded opponents in both the primary and general elections.
Tom Coburn is an exceptional man. I love him as a friend and admire him as a
statesman. I believe that his presence in the United States Senate will make a significant
difference for the future of our country. Speaking as a private individual and not on
behalf of the organization I lead, let me say that I hope you will consider voting for this
man of deep convictions about the things that matter most. It is my sincere opinion that if
you care about the future of the family and about the traditional moral principles on
which the nation was founded, you should consider helping to elect Dr. Tom Coburn to
the U.S. Senate.
-- James C Dobson, Ph.D.
